NIT Betting Preview: Dayton at Ohio State Pick

SBG Global Opening Line: Ohio State  - 8.5, Total 125.5

Two teams that just missed getting into the NCAA Tournament will meet in the NIT quarterfinals on Wednesday as Ohio State hosts Dayton. The Buckeyes have defeated UNC Asheville (84-66) and California (73-56) while Dayton has won against Cleveland State (66-57) and Illinois State (55-48). SBG Global reports that early NCAA Basketball betting has the public taking Ohio State at Home.

The winner of the game will take on the winner of the game between Virginia Tech and Mississippi in the NIT Semifinals in New York next week. Ohio State is 3-2 overall in the series with Dayton that was first played in 1934 and most recently in 1988. The Buckeyes are 1-1 vs. the Flyers in Columbus. Ohio State is 29-13 vs. the Atlantic 10 in their history. Head coach Thad Matta, who coached for three seasons in the Atlantic 10 Conference while the head coach at Xavier, is 7-1 all-time vs. Dayton. Ohio State is 14-3 in Value City Arena this season and 2-0 at St. John Arena. Wednesday’s game will be at the Value City Arena. Ohio State is playing Dayton on the anniversary of the 1986 NIT title game that the Buckeyes won over Wyoming 73-63.


SBG Global Current Line: Ohio State - 8 , Total 125.5

Dayton enters the game winning six of its last seven. The Flyers are making their 14th appearance in the NIT quarterfinals and their first since the 2000-01 season. Dayton’s defense has held 13 straight opponents to less than 50 percent shooting from the field.

Here are the NCAA Basketball betting stats for Wednesday’s game. The Flyers are 7-1 ATS in their last 8 non-conference games. The Flyers are 4-1 ATS in their last 5 games vs. a team with a winning record. The Flyers are 4-1 ATS in their last 5 games overall. The Flyers are 1-4 ATS in their last 5 Wednesday games.

The Buckeyes are 5-0 ATS in their last 5 non-conference games. The Buckeyes are 11-5-1 ATS in their last 17 games vs. a team with a winning record.

The Over is 7-2 in the Flyers last 9 non-conference games. The Under is 5-2 in the Flyers last 7 Wednesday games.

The Under is 5-1 in the Buckeyes last 6 Wednesday games. The Under is 8-2 in the Buckeyes last 10 non-conference games. The Under is 10-4 in the Buckeyes last 14 home games.

Guide to The Philippines Best Tourism Spots

If you want to a take a vacation that will offer you nearly limitless possibilities of things to do and memories that will last a life time without spending a fortune then the Philippines are for you. Consisting of more than 7000 islands the Philippines have something for everyone to enjoy. If its nature you're interested in then you can go scuba diving, hiking in the mountains or take a short boat rides to one of the many islands for some site seeing. The Philippines have the largest concentration of different species of wildlife for their size than any other place in the world. Not into nature? Just want to do some site seeing. You can move around the cities easily and view the people and culture. The Philippines have some Cathedrals here that are hundreds of years old and are spectacular. If night life is your thing there is no shortage of that here. Casinos in the Major Cities and clubs and restaurants are every where.


You won't have to walk around with a pocket translator and worry about communicating with the residents. English is spoken by most Filipinos. Currency is not a problem either since there are numerous places where you can convert your cash to the local currency and Visa is readily accepted by most major establishments. Sample the local cuisine and if you find your self missing some of your old favorites there are McDonalds , KFC and Pizza Hut here as well as a number of restaurants that serve western style cuisine. Last of all I want to mention the people. They are fantastic. Friendly, quick to smile and always polite. They love foreigners here and make you feel special when you visit. Chances are good if you visit once you will come back. You may also meet some of the many foreigners that now call the Philippines home.

Baguio

Baguio, aka the “Summer Capital of the Philippines.” rest some 1,500 meters above sea level, in the Cordillera Central mountain range in northern Luzon. The city is well-known for its mild climate. Because of its high altitude the temp range averages between 15 - 23 degrees Celsius, rarely exceeding 26"C. If you’re a nature lover and prefer a milder climate, you won’t be disappointed. There are plenty of parks, Botanical gardens and hiking available. You will also find markets, shops, local crafts, Mansion House (official residence of the president of the Republic of the Philippines), Asin Hot Springs and many more. There’s even an 18 hole par 61 golf course at the Baguio Country Club. The club has 200 guestrooms and suites to accommodate guest.



Batanes Islands

Batanes is the northernmost province in the Philippines. It’s also the smallest as far as land mass and population. This is a nature lovers dream with plenty of opportunities for fishing, diving and hiking. This small group of islands sits where the Pacific ocean meets the China Sea and is home to some of the rarest corals in the world.

Two of the more popular islands are Sabtang and Itbayat. Both are accessible by boat from the capital Bacso. Sabtang is only a 30 minute ride by boat while Itbayat can take 4 hours. Charter planes are available that make the trip in 30 min. If you choose to go by boat be prepared for active ride. The seas can be a little choppy. Itbayat terrain consist of rolling hills and semi level plateaus surrounded by continuous massive cliffs rising up to 70 meters above sea level. There are no shorelines. Sabtang is quite different though, it has many small flat areas spread out on its coasts and its interior consist by steep mountains and very deep canyons. Sabtang does have some stretches of sandy beaches and or rocky shorelines.

Batan is another great island to visit for hikers Similar in topography as Sabtang it offers long stretches of hills where animals graze, a ghost town, deserted after years of beatings by storms and the “radar Yuron” an abandoned weather station that offers a 360 degree view of the island.

Bohol Philippines


Bohol

Bohol is a beautiful island paradise located in the Visayas island group in central Philippines. It is famous for its white sand beaches, the Chocolate Hills and the Tarsier, the smallest primate in the world. It is surrounded by beautiful beaches and corral reefs. If you love nature then Bohal is the destination for you. There are also more than 1400 caves to explore. The most famous of these is Hinagdanan Cave's on Panglao island. The cave leads to an underground pool with plenty of stalactites' & stalagmites. There is even a sanctuary for the Tarsiers called the Tarsier Trail.Here visitors are allowed to hold and touch the tiny little primates. The towns in Bohol have many old churches dating back to the Spanish error to see. You can even do some dolphin & whale watching at Pamilacan Island. Bohol is definitely worth a visit by itself or if your in Cebu it's only about a two hour boat ride away to see the sites and return in the evening.

Boracay Philippines


Boracay Island

The beaches of the Boracay Island is located off the north-western tip of Panay Island, Philippines. Boracay is world famous for its beaches and is usually the first place mentioned when talking about Philippine vacation spots. scuba diving, snorkeling & sunbathing and sailing in a slender hulled boats called Paraw are common attractions. The ride in the Paraw is fast and a lot of fun if you don't mind getting wet At night there is plenty to with numerous clubs and bars scattered along the beach. The Lenten and Christmas seasons are the most popular times to visit because of the fiestas. For those of you that like golf there is a 18 hole, par 72 golf course at Filinvest's Fairways & Blue Waters located not far from the beach.

Cebu Philippines

Cebu City

Cebu is an island province better known as the Queen City of the South. Cebu is a popular destination for millions of foreigners from all over the world and Filipino’s to. Cebu is one of the oldest cities of the country and the place where Magellan landed and was killed in battle of Mactan. The site has monuments to both Magellan and Lapu lapu and is an interesting place to visit. Then there’s the “Taoist Temple” on you way to “ the Top” a small park on top of a mountain. It’s the highest peek in Cebu and one can see the entire city from there. The view is incredible especially at night when one can see the lights from the city. If you visit in January, you can see the “Sinulog Festival” held during the third week. Then of course there’s the beaches and some world class scuba diving on Mactan Island. There are several multi story malls and many public markets to visit. Not your cup of tea? Then how about the Casino and there’s an abundance of night clubs and bars to visit. You can also go island hopping to the near by islands that surround Cebu. This is one destination you won’t be disappointed in no matter what time of year you come.

Dapitan City

Dapitan city is located on the northwestern coast of Zamboanga del Norte in Mindanao. The city of Dapitan is famous for the “Rizal shrine” and its world class beach resort, Dakak. It has a beautiful powdery white sand beach and some spectacular coral reefs for diving. It is called the “Diving Mecca in Mindanao”. The 750 meter private beach rest in a beautiful bay and at night guest can dine on grilled seafood and other Philippine cuisine while enjoying some live entertainment.


Davao City

Davao City is considered as one of the most liveable cities in Asia by Asiaweek and included among the top 10 Asian cities by Foreign Direct Investment (FDI). It is located on the southeastern portion of Mindanao. Davao is famous for many things including eagles, gold, beautiful attractions, landscapes and white sand beaches. There are numerous parks and conservation centers to visit. The night life offers jazz clubs, piano bars, excellent restaurants, concerts, festivals and night clubs. If you like shopping there are multi story malls and markets where you can buy any thing from fresh produce and crafts to jewellery. Transportation is abundant with cabs everywhere. If your feeling adventurous take a Jeepney or tricycle.

Kasawan Falls - Cebu

Kawasan Falls is a very popular destination in the southern part of Cebu. About a 2-hour drive located in Badian Town, once there you will have to walk about 20 minutes or less along a very rocky and narrow path. There's a beautiful river and many different varieties of tropical plants along the way. The view is spectacular. Have your camera ready because you will have to cross three small bridges along the way and this will give you a perfect opportunity to take some great pictures. Once there food and drinks area available as well as some cottages and tables for rent. There are water three falls here. The first will be the largest. The paths leading of to the other two is not too difficult to navigate and well worth the trip. You will find more tables available at the other falls. If you don’t like crowds I recommend you go during the week. Transportation to the falls is available via a V-Hire van. It’s a full size van that can seat 10 comfortably.


Mayon Volcano,

The Mayon Volcano, also known as Mount Mayon, is an active stratovolcano in the province of Albay, in the Bicol Region, on the island of Luzon, in the Philippines.
Renowned as the "Perfect Cone" because of its almost perfectly conical shape, Mayon is situated 15 kilometers northwest of Legazpi City.

The Mayon Volcano is an extraordinary site but remember it is active and any plans to visit the area should be proceeded by checking local conditions and monitoring the volcano’s activity. More information about this natural wonder can be found here. http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Mayon_Volcano


Metro Manila

Manila is the capital of the Philippines. It is actually a part on metro Manila which consist on 17 cities with a population of over 10 million people. The city is a mix of the old and new buildings.
Some centuries old. Metropolitan Manila is the country's economic, cultural, educational, and industrial center. Shopping and night life is everywhere here. There small markets and boutiques to giant malls. In addition there are countless bars, restaurants, discos, Karaoke lounges, piano bars and café's to visit. A few must sees would include The walled city of Intramuros, Manila Ocean Park and Malacañang Palace, the official residence of the president of Philippines. If the traffic and large crowds are not to your liking you can go north to northwards to explore the highlands. If its beaches you want then head south to Mindoro. Whatever your taste you will likely find plenty to do here.


Palawan

Palawan is largest and most well preserved island group in the Philippines consisting of 1700 islands.The rain forest, caves, coral reefs, mangroves, beaches and beautiful clear blue waters are just some the wonderful things you will see there. There's over 10,000 square kilometers of coral reefs surrounding the islands. Some must see attractions include Puerto Princess Subterranean River National Park. A.k.a. Sabang's St. Paul Subterranean National Park. Formed naturally over millions of years; the exact length of the caves and river network is still unknown. The Stalactite and stalagmites and multi colored stones in the caverns are a wonder to see. If you like diving there's Tubbataha Reef National Marine Park. Tubbataha Reef is made consist of 2 atolls. The northern most serves as a sanctuary for birds ans sea turtles. The Capital of Palawan, Puerto Princes offers some night life with several clubs and bars. If its nature and diving you are seeking then Palawan would be tough to beat.

Siargao Island Philippines

Siargao Island

Siargao Island is the #1 surfing destination in the Philippines situated in the pristine and backdrop of the Surigao del Norte paradise. It is Fed by the waves of the Pacific Ocean, this island is the Philippine’s alternative to Oahu and Tahiti. The island is home to roughly 200,000 Filipinos and has a well preserved wetland of mangroves (largest in Mindanao) in the south and west, and a sprawling coastline composed of white sand beaches and unspoiled lagoons in the east which faces the Pacific Ocean. Siargao has excellent surfing conditions, particularly during the southwest "habagat" monsoon from August to November, when the prevailing wind is offshore. There are many beautiful reefs to see also if you like diving. It is recommended you use a local guide if its your first time here to avoid the potential hazards.

Siargao’s nightlife is mainly along General Luna, especially near Cloud Nine where local and foreign tourists gather for annual surfing and other activities. Bars and discos are very busy along this stretch of beach and really come alive at night. I is also recommenced that you bring enough pesos with you since there aren’t many places to change your money here.

Visa Information

In most cases tourist visas aren't necessary for entry to the Philippines. You will need a valid passport and tickets and documents for return or onward travel. You are allowed to stay for 21 days. If you plan to exceed that you need to apply for a visa extension at the local immigration office before the 21 days are up. The extension will allow to you to stay for a total of 59 days. You can extend again but do it within the 59 day period. Converting your cash to local currency the peso is easily done as there are plenty of outlets all over the cities and to get you started you can exchange some at the airports. Visa and Master Card are readily accepted at most establishments here. You will find your money goes a very long way here.
